Calciomercato Monza, Antov rewarded with renewal

AC Monza

Newly promoted Monza has announced that it has extended the contract for the sports performance of Valentin Antov until June 30, 2027, with automatic renewal for one more season if certain conditions are met. Arriving in Brianza in the summer of 2021, the Bulgarian defender immediately won promotion to Serie A with the Biancorossi, with whom he collected a total of 21 appearances.

After his adventure on loan at Cremonese, with whom he experienced another promotion to Serie A last season, Antov returned to Monza in the summer of 2025. Returning after a long injury suffered in the previous season’s finale, he experienced his second promotion to Serie A with the “biancorossi,” taking the field in the return playoff final against Catanzaro: a few minutes but done well in a moment of extreme difficulty for Paolo Bianco’s team.

His comeback had been gradual: his first call-up in the Biancorosso in the Serie B season had come on the occasion of the Genoa away match against Sampdoria in April, a concrete sign of the Bulgarian defender’s physical recovery after the problems that had kept him away from the fields.

The final against Catanzaro, in which Antov made his entrance, was an evening of great tension at the U-Power Stadium. The Brianzoli, on the strength of a 2-0 first leg lead signed by Hernani and Caso, had to deal with a Calabrian comeback that went all the way to 2-0 in the second half, with goals from Fellipe Jack and Frosinini. Catanzaro came close to pulling off a miracle, but failed to find the third goal that would have overturned the overall result.At the triple whistle, Monza was back in Serie A thanks to the best league standings.

Antov’s renewal is part of a broader strategy to consolidate the Brianza squad ahead of a return to the top flight. A few days earlier, the club had also armored Samuele Birindelli, extending the Tuscan outfielder’s contract until June 30, 2028 with an option for one more season. Birindelli, the absolute protagonist of the promotional ride with five goals in 37 appearances, had been deployed as a starter in the very final return match against Catanzaro, helping to hold up the impact of the Calabrian comeback in Paolo Bianco’s three-man defense.
